Linux 怎么给文件夹添加备注
- 0次
- 2021-06-16 17:05:27
- idczone
linux 怎么给文件夹添加备注
就是平常自己项目多,分不清哪个文件是哪个项目,都要一个一个去打开去看才能确定项目
例如:
----------------------------------------------------------
> ls
> folder-1 folder-2 folder-3
----------------------------------------------------------
想要的结果:
----------------------------------------------------------
> ls
> folder-1 (文件 1 ) folder-2 (文件 2 ) folder-3 (文件 3 )
----------------------------------------------------------
有哪位大牛能指点指点!
曲线救国?
[[email&tmp]mkdir test
[[email&tmp]cd $_
[[email&test]mkdir {f1,f2,f3}
[[email&test]echo 111 > f1/111.tag
[[email&test]echo 222 > f2/222.tag
[[email&test]echo 333 > f3/333.tag
[[email&test]ll f*/*.tag
-rw-r--r-- 1 root root 4 Sep 27 14:14 f1/111.tag
-rw-r--r-- 1 root root 4 Sep 27 14:14 f2/222.tag
-rw-r--r-- 1 root root 4 Sep 27 14:14 f3/333.tag
[[email&test]#
没有
你干嘛不在文件夹名字上体现
没有这个功能
太难看了
没有,下一个
最省事的,装个 broot,直接显示目录下树状结构,快速判断。
https://github.com/Canop/broot
这种思路是我最初想使用的,非常棒
感谢推荐,试了一下这个真的好用。
更进一步
[[email&tmp]mkdir {f1,f2,f3}
[[email&tmp]setfattr -n user.ns -v soft f1
[[email&tmp]setfattr -n user.ns -v music f2
[[email&tmp]getfattr -n user.ns {f1,f2,f3}
file: f1
user.ns="soft"
file: f2
user.ns="music"
f3: user.ns: No such attribute
[图片]( http://chuantu.xyz/t6/741/1601195153x236107646.jpg)
貌似 Mac 的文件 /文件夹注释不是写到文件,记得是生成 .DS_Store 文件,在文件里写入并映射绑定的
囧,好像也不是,刚试了下把.DS_Store 文件删了,注释还在
查了下,看到这篇文,介绍说现在的 macOS 应该是用文件扩展属性单存了注释内容 https://juejin.im/post/6844903869667868686
文件夹里写个 read.me?
秒啊
当然是在文件夹下放个 readme.md 文件啊,有些文件管理程序,例如 github 、nextcloud 等,就支持在查看目录时在页面顶部显示 readme.md 内的内容。
kde 的 dolphin 支持这个功能,还能给文件(夹)评分,打标签
通过添加文件扩展属性